Eat the right way

When you buy your groceries, avoid processed food items like chips, nutrition bars, frozen meals etc. Always make sure that your cart is filled with fresh items like fruits, veggies, and yogurt. Rather than eating out, cook your own food at home. This way you can portion control and add the right ingredients. Instead of having three grand meals, divide your meals into five small ones, which will make sure that you don’t overeat unintentionally in the form of snacks. To tingle your taste buds and not make eating homemade food boring, you can also plan out a week’s food schedule beforehand.

Stay Hydrated

Drinking water is the easiest and cheapest way to have a healthy lifestyle. Water is very important when it comes to burning up fat and washing out all the toxins from the body. Keeping your body hydrated is the best way to rev up the metabolism and making sure that all the organs in our body work properly. Drinking water helps you absorb nutrients from your food easily and also improves your digestion. Studies have shown that sometimes our body confuses hunger with thirst and dehydration; drinking water can help settle that. It is generally advised to drink between 1.5 to 2 liters of water during the whole day.

Exercise without a gym

In this era of technology, everything you need is a click away. Doing a good workout at home is super easy. You can easily get workout DVDs or you can just use your monthly internet package to search for workout videos on Youtube. Nowadays, there are plentiful apps which provide free, perfectly crafted workout routines which can come in handy to get fit at home. All you need to do now is clear up some space at your home and exercise away.

Have a more active lifestyle

Moving your body only during exercise is not just it. The small actions that you add into your daily life can have a big effect on your fitness. No matter how busy you are, find ways to be more active. A busy day can sometimes become a hurdle in your daily workout schedule and you can miss one day easily. So what you can do are a few squats and also some stretching while you talk to your client on phone. You can have a standing desk or make a rough version of it to keep you more on your feet instead of sitting in your office the whole day.
